Cross-linked polystyrene and polydivinylbenzene (PDVB) have unreacted pendant vinyl groups. They readily undergo aging or oxidation with air even at room temperature, giving rise to formation of OH and (CO)CH3 groups within the polymers. We now report that the aging process involves the release of carbon monoxide (CO) and hydrogen (H2) in significant amounts at 40 C and the rate increases with time and temperature. The amounts of CO and H2 released from PDVB at a given temperature can be expressed using a polyno- mial equation of Aa = Bt + Ct2, where Aa is the accumulated amount, t is the time in the unit of day, and B and C are the coefficients. The coefficients B and D increase with increasing temperature. This result shows that the storage rooms for the above polymers and their composites should be well ventilated to prevent inhalation of CO by the workers and H2-induced potential hazards.

We report the map of 20 reactions that take place during vapor-phase photo- chemical dehydrogenation of ethanol on four metal-doped TiO2 (Mn/TiO2, Mn = nanoparticles of Pd, Pt, Au, and Cu) under solar simulated light. The reac- tions are sensitively affected by the moisture amount and the nature of the car- rier gas. To construct the above map, we also used CH3CHO, CH3CO2H, (C2H5O)2CHCH3, and CH3CO2C2H5, respectively, as an independent starting reagent. Amazingly, Mn/TiO2 not only serves as photocatalysts but also as ther- mocatalysts for various reactions that appear in the above map. The reaction is proposed to proceed by a radical mechanism in which photoinduced electron transfer from the valence band to the conduction band of TiO2 is the initial step and the subsequent electron injection from organic reactants to the hole in the TiO2 valence band. This report also features highly valuable unprece- dented reactions, which bear great potential to be commercialized.
